Transaction 967066d32a5549a9bb38afee68e37910d67580f9880d249abcb989e1c253a403
1 Input
1 Output
-
967066d32a5549a9bb38afee68e37910d67580f9880d249abcb989e1c253a403:0
- value
- 21817590
- script pubkey
- OP_0 OP_PUSHBYTES_20 b2c87f5584d1ea2488ece7df6b2f7f9a6982ac56
- address
- bc1qkty874vy684zfz8vul0kktmlnf5c9tzkutn5gh